Wilks, aka Nick Wilkinson, returns with A Soul to Borrow, a six-track EP that fuses intricate electronic textures with hypnotic rhythms. The record channels the spirit of classic-era ambient-IDM stalwarts like Gimmik, Arovane, Bauri, Esem, Loess, Penfold Plum, and Bola, creating a shimmering, immersive sonic journey.
